瀧 / Japanese Kanji Meanings & Readings

What does 瀧 mean?

Waterfall

How to read 瀧?

Kunyomi... たき/taki

Onyomi... ロウ/ro

jinmeikun...

* There are two typical ways of reading kanji, kun-yomi and on-yomi. In addition, there is a reading system called "jinmei kun" which is used only for names.

Other kanji information..

application

Can be registered as a Japanese name

In Japan, 2999 kanji characters can be registered as names. (In other words, you cannot officially apply for any other kanji as a name.) But if you enjoy it as fiction, no problem.

type kanji officially for use in names
unicode 7027

&#x7027 (For HTML use)
